Os cálculos se iniciam pelo preenchimento das variáveis de projeto, que devem ser fornecidas pelo usuário através do preenchimento das células amarelas, que são as únicas acessíveis. O diâmetro é escolhido em uma norma para tubulações de aço, muito embora sejam fornecidas as opções de oito materiais diferentes. O usuário deve estar atento a esse detalhe! Como o tubo selecionado para a descarga não é SN40 e preferimos trabalhar com essa bitola, vamos diminuindo o valor da velocidade de descarga até acharmos um SN40 no banco de dados. Com 1,8 m/s encontramos o 3" S.N.40, cujo diâmetro interno é de 77,9 mm. 3o passo - Demais variáveis de projeto: Nosso sistema tem as seguintes características: 1. A linha de sucção tem comprimento total de 2 + 8 + 2 = 12 m. 2. Coloquemos esse valor na célula LS (m) da planilha "Variáveis de Projeto". 3. A linha de descarga tem comprimento total de 17 m. 4. Coloquemos esse valor na célula LD (m) da planilha "Variáveis de Projeto". 5. A linha de sucção apresenta 1 cotovelo padrão (Leq/D = 30 ) e 1 saída te tanque (Leq/D = 25). Como o diâmetro de sucção é 0,1023 m resulta SLeqS = 0,1023 * 55 = 5,6 m 6. Coloquemos esse valor na célula SLeqS (m) da planilha "Variáveis de Projeto". 7. A linha de descarga apresenta 1 saída de tulação (Leq/D = 45 ). Como o diâmetro de sucção é 0,0779 m resulta SLeqD = 0,0779 * 45 = 3,5 m 8. Coloquemos esse valor na célula SLeqD (m) da planilha "Variáveis de Projeto". 9. Os tanques estão abertos para a atmosfera. Podemos admitir que os valores das pressões de ambos sejam iguais a 1 bar. 10. Coloquemos esse valor nas células P1 e P4. 11. O nível do tanque de alimentação está 5,5 m abaixo do nível da bomba, enquanto que o de descarga está 22 m acima. 12. Na planilha "Variáveis de Projeto" coloquemos os respectivos valores das cotas: z1 = - 5,5 m e z4 = 22 m. Após essas etapas todos os cálculos já foram efetuados e os resultados estão apresentados na planilha A.M.T. (Altura Manométrica Total). Neste exemplo H = 28,43 m e NPSHd = 4,29 m. Teoricamente, até 3500 rpm nenhuma bomba cavitaria, embora o fator de Thoma tenda a subestimar os valores de NPSHr. O ideal seria a consulta ao fabricante da bomba. O usuário pode fazer as análises que interessem, variando valores das células amarelas. Por exemplo, neste caso, se alterarmos a temperatura para 70oC o programa indica que haverá cavitação para rotações acima de 2000 rpm. -5,5 m 2 m 2 m 0 m 8 m 22 m 17 m Seleção de Diâmetro SUCÇÃO vRS(m/s) DRS(m) DS(m) DN(pol) SN SS (m2) e/Ds 1 O.K.! 0.0995 0.1023 4 STD 40/40S 0.008 0.000440 DESCARGA vRD(m/s) DRD(m) DD(m) DN(pol) SN SD (m2) e/DD 1.8 O.K.! 0.0742 0.0779 3 STD/40/40S 0.005 0.000578 * FORA DA FAIXA 0 NPS S.N.
